Sydney Pollack (born July 1 1934 in Lafayette, Indiana) is an American actor, producer, and director. His career began in the Sixties, directing episodes of TV series like The Fugitive and Alfred Hitchcock Presents.
He won a Academy Award for Directing for Out of Africa.
